Output 24d6fe624253761e77d804598acdc937cf3ad465317d74c80154ae75d54195e2:4

value
870607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87abeb86a7f2f4c17284d549931f1895a2b38274 OP_EQUAL
address
3E4P6erdrcWEuutXJzHDEJohrPo57xHKke
transaction
24d6fe624253761e77d804598acdc937cf3ad465317d74c80154ae75d54195e2
spent
true